CHAPTER 215

(HB 1032)

Resident hunting and fishing privileges
altered upon a change of residency.


         ENTITLED, An Act to  clarify that hunting, fishing, and trapping privileges associated with a resident license continue after change of residency.

B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F SOUTH DAKOTA:

     Section  1.  That subdivision (22) of § 41-1-1 be amended to read as follows:

             (22)      "Resident," a person actually living within and intending to make the person's home in this state. However, any person who has lawfully acquired a resident hunting, fishing, or trapping license and who leaves the state after acquiring the license to take up residency elsewhere may continue to exercise all the privileges granted by the license until the license expires if the person's respective privileges are not revoked or suspended pursuant to § §  41-6-75 to 41-6-75.2, inclusive. No resident may lose rights under this title by reason of the resident's absence on business of the United States or of this state, or armed services of the United States or the spouse of an active duty military person, or any student regularly attending a school of higher learning as a full-time student;
